Vuvuzela now in Oxford English Dictionary
by Zenith Tarmac on 19 August, 2010 - 06:39
Love the plastic “Horn of Africa” or hate it but it has made its way into the Oxford English Dictionary. The Vuvuzela came to worldwide attention during the football World Cup in South Africa.
The Vuvuzela entry into the Oxford Dictionary of English is due to be published Thursday.
The Oxford dictionary is based on how language is really used. Its definition for the horn is a ‘long plastic instrument in the shape of a trumpet; that makes a very loud noise when you blow it and is popular with football fans in South Africa”.
